Abstract
A readout ASIC for GEM (gas electron multiplier) detectors is present. It consists of a low-noise charge preamplifier, a CR-(RC)4 semi-Gaussian shaper and a class-AB buffer for each channel. Fabricated in 0.35 mum CMOS process, it takes about 150 mum x 1500 mum die area and dissipates less than 10 mW per channel. The detailed design and preliminary test results are reported.
